The sustainability workshops program aims to foster community resilience through sharing knowledge and growing connections. The Workshops Producer and Office Manager will program and produce The Canberra Environment Centre’s ongoing Sustainability Workshops program. They will maintain and build strong networks with workshop presenters and sustainability knowledge holders in the Canberra community. The workshop producer will work with an Outreach Officer to host the majority of the workshops.
Knowledge or interest in topics relating to practical sustainability is a strong advantage. Our program includes topics such as backyard food growing, chicken keeping and beekeeping, sustainable fashion, introduction to solar, urban foraging, recycling education and sourdough bread baking. We draw upon knowledgeable and skilled members of our community to present our workshops; the workshops producer must have a high level of familiarity with the topics in order to successfully curate the sustainability workshops program.
Office Manager duties include ensuring the CEC is tidy and functional for events, managing bookings with our community stakeholders to use the space, and answering phone and email enquiries.

We are an environmental education centre that empowers people to create a sustainable future for the Canberra community. Our premises, located in Acton, includes a community workshop and meeting space, an environmental library, a community garden and a community bike workshop.
The Canberra Environment Centre provides quality workshops on all aspects of sustainable living. We schedule at least six workshops per month delivered to the public, both online and in person. We also provide workshop directly to community groups, business and government.
